Deepening the Practice

Second-year students took on more complex challenges this term, including advanced drawing, portraiture, and colour theory. One of their standout projects was a collaborative mandala collagraph, where they combined technical skill with teamwork, pattern, and rhythm.

Exploring New Ideas
Professor Marija Marcelionytė-Paliukė of the Vilnius Academy of Arts (Lithuania) Department of Graphic Arts led a visual expression and printmaking workshop for third-year students of the Faculty of Arts of the University of Johannesburg (UJ) and Artist Proof Studio (APS). This exchange introduced alternative etching techniques and new ways of thinking about the medium, sparking exciting experimentation and conversation between the two groups. Learn more.


Printmakers Shaping Their Communities
Beyond the studio, one of our graduates led a monotype workshop for over 40 children at the Children’s Disability Project (CDP). This community engagement initiative reflects our belief that education doesn’t stop at the classroom, giving back is part of learning too.
